The MAX4259ESD+T is a voltage-feedback operational amplifier that amplifies input signals with high speed and accuracy. It operates by receiving an input signal through the IN+ pin and comparing it with the reference voltage at the IN- pin. The amplified output signal is then provided through the OUT pin. The amplifier operates within a specified supply voltage range and utilizes a voltage-feedback architecture to ensure precise amplification.
